H2O Purification Systems : Integrating Electrical Deionization, Membrane Filtration, and Ultrafiltration
Modern liquid purification equipment frequently integrate multiple approaches to realize exceptional quality . For Ultrafiltration Membranes example, a typical configuration utilizes membrane filtration as a initial stage to discard larger particles , followed by membrane filtration to exclude dissolved minerals and then electrical deionization for ultimate conditioning and reliable conductivity lowering . This integrated solution offers a highly efficient response for demanding industries requiring high water quality .
Prolonging Membrane Longevity: Optimal Practices for RO Systems, UF, and Electrodeionization
To achieve sustained performance and lessen substitution costs for your RO , UF, and EDI processes, following best procedures is vital. Scheduled cleaning is key, employing compatible chemicals based on scale nature. Pre-treatment steps should be carefully observed and adjusted to restrict filter soiling. Moreover, maintaining proper working force and flow inside the supplier's specified limits is crucial for prolonging media longevity.
